Andy Flint, Head of Business Development, ABC
In 2006, when we collaborated with the IAB US to create the IAB/ABC International Spiders and Bots List, we at ABC saw that invalid traffic was inflating online figures by as much as 60%. What we didn’t know was that 10 years later it would be costing the ad industry £5.5billion in wasted display revenue, according to research company Forrester.

ABC, the leading UK digital verification expert and Joint Industry Currency for media measurement, has been authorised by the Trustworthy Accountability Group (TAG), an advertising industry initiative to fight criminal activity in the digital advertising supply chain, as an outside auditor for its “TAG Certified Against Fraud,” “TAG Certified Against Piracy,” and “TAG Certified Against Malware” Programs. As an independent verification provider, ABC UK will ensure that companies have met the rigorous standards for each program and are qualified to receive a TAG Seal in the relevant area.

Global leads the way for Digital Audio Brand Safety – First media owner in digital audio to receive JICWEBS accreditation.
The Joint Industry Committee for Web Standards (JICWEBS) has awarded Global, the Media & Entertainment group, certification for its brand safety standards and measures to tackle digital ad fraud. Global is the first media owner in digital audio to achieve this.

The WFA Global Media Charter calls for agencies, ad-tech companies, media owners and platforms to work alongside advertisers to create a safer, more transparent, more consumer-friendly environment
The World Federation of Advertisers has published a Global Media Charter, designed to create the conditions for a marketing ecosystem that works better for brands and consumers.
